StarSight Autonomous System

A revolutionary new navigation system that knows many objects to avoid; a solid Lidar that scans the surroundings in 3D. Thanks to that, the robot has a shorter body.

The difference:

Brushroll system. The Qrevo Slim has a dual roller system, as seen in the Roborock S8 MaxV Ultra. The Saros 10R has a DuoDivide that makes its best to resist hair tangling. The DuoDivide is the newest and most efficient brushroll system made for pet owners.

AdaptLift Chassis technology lifts the robot higher, which increases its climbing ability up to 1.4 in. The Slim doesn't have it.

Suction. The Saros has more power than the Qrevo Slim.

Body height. The Saros has a shorter body.

Obstacle avoidance. The Saros has advanced technology and is better at recognizing and avoiding objects.

Flexi arm and mop. Both cleaners extend the side brush and a mop along the walls and corners, but unlike Slim, the Saros additionally lifts the side brush and adapts it to the cleaning situation.

Unlike Slim, the Saros has better obstacle avoidance, the newest brushroll system that resists tangles, adaptive lifting so the robot climbs a higher obstacle, adapts into cleaning environment automatically, and has the most advanced self-cleaning station.

The Saros automatically lifts its side sweeper, roller brush, and mopping pad depending on the cleaning situation; it adapts cleaning settings relying on how often the household has been cleaned.

The station uses warm water to refill the tank, wash the mops, and clean the base which makes the robot a better option as a mopping robot than the previous models.

The Saros is a rich-featured robot that does the job as a vacuum and a mop at the same time. Intelligent enough to do the chores on its own.

The robot has 22k Pa of power which makes the Saros series the most powerful in the industry.

Has StarSight which is the newest mapping technology thanks to which the robot goes under most furniture. Knows the biggest amount of small objects to avoid. It uses the same Dual rollers and lacks the AdaptLift Chassis so it can't go under anything higher than 20 mm.

The Qrevo Slim is a great device but it lacks some important features since it has a previous-gen base that doesn't fill the water tank with warm water or wash the base with it. It doesn't have detergent refill.

The Slim is a short robot that gets under most furniture, is a good robot mop if you need mopping, and a great value for a home with a mixed surface.

Which one to get?

The Roborock Saros 10R is the latest and most-featured robot vacuum on the market. If you need smooth mopping experience, the base that cleans itself so it doesn't stink afterwards, better get the Saros. It would be more precise with avoiding objects, smartly doing its job so you don't have to set it. 

The robot has the latest base, the advanced roller system, and climbs on a higher obstacle when needed. For $200 more dollars, I would recommend considering the Saros hovewer, the Slim does seem like a great option if you don't mind lack of the premium features the Saros has.
